What are some common challenges faced by Tree Workers on the job, and how are they addressed?

Tree Workers often face challenges such as working at heights, handling heavy equipment, and navigating unpredictable outdoor conditions. Safety is a primary concern, so workers are trained extensively in proper use of climbing gear, chainsaws, and personal protective equipment. Teamwork is essential, as tasks like tree removal or pruning require close coordination and clear communication with ground crew and supervisors to ensure everyone's safety. Employers usually provide ongoing safety training and opportunities to gain advanced certifications, helping Tree Workers stay prepared and advance in their careers.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Tree Worker,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Tree Worker, you need knowledge of arboriculture, tree biology, and safe equipment operation, often supported by a high school diploma and on-the-job training. Familiarity with chainsaws, climbing gear, wood chippers, and certifications like ISA Certified Arborist are typically required. Strong teamwork, attention to detail, and effective communication are essential soft skills for safety and efficiency. These skills and qualifications are crucial for maintaining safety standards, protecting property, and ensuring healthy tree care.

What are tree workers called?

Tree workers are commonly called arborists, tree climbers, or tree surgeons. They specialize in planting, pruning, and removing trees, often using tools like chainsaws and safety gear, and may hold certifications such as Certified Arborist. Their work environment is typically outdoors, often involving climbing or working at heights.

What is the difference between Tree Worker vs Arborist?

AspectTree WorkerArborist
CertificationsTypically OSHA safety training, sometimes industry-specificCertified Arborist credential (ISA), advanced safety and pruning certifications
Work EnvironmentOutdoor, on trees, in various weather conditionsOutdoor, often involves consulting, pruning, and tree health assessments
Job ResponsibilitiesClimbing, pruning, cutting, and removal of treesTree care, pruning, disease diagnosis, and consulting

While both Tree Workers and Arborists work outdoors and handle tree-related tasks, Tree Workers primarily focus on physical tree climbing, cutting, and removal. Arborists often have specialized certifications and perform more consultative and health assessments. The roles overlap in work environment and safety requirements, but Arborists typically possess advanced knowledge and credentials.

What are tree workers?

Tree workers, also known as arborists or tree care professionals, are individuals trained to maintain, prune, remove, and care for trees and shrubs. Their work involves tasks like trimming branches, diagnosing tree health, removing hazardous trees, and sometimes planting new trees. Tree workers use specialized equipment and must follow safety protocols due to the physical risks involved in their job. They play a key role in maintaining the health and safety of urban and rural landscapes.
